Valtech’s valuation team has recently completed a long service payment (“LSP”) valuation for a Hong Kong-based NGO.
A common characteristic of NGO’s employee dataset is that NGO often provide voluntary MPF contributions to their employees referring to the employee’s accumulated service year. The voluntary contribution percentage may also vary based on the service year of the employees. Most of the time, there will also be a vesting schedule of voluntary MPF, which further increased the complexity of estimating potential payout amount of LSP caused by variable offset amount of voluntary MPF.

Abolition of MPF Offsetting Arrangement
The abolition of MPF offsetting arrangement officially took effect on 1 May 2025. Starting from May, all newly employed staff’s mandatory MPF contribution cannot be adopted to offset LSP, the same applies to the post-transition portion’s LSP of current staff.
As a general reminder, given that pre-transition portion of LSP payment is determined by the last full month’s wages of the employee before transition (most likely April 2025), it is suggested that employers should keep the record of all current staff’s salary systematically to avoid over/under-estimation of provisions.
